My kids are already here obviously, but older than yours. In terms of attractions for kids, there is a nice water park that is close to walking distance from the hotel. Worlds of Fun and Oceans of Fun are good for older kids -- they are about 20 minutes away.
I don't know whether the hotel has a pool or not -- I'd think so but have not checked it out. For the 4-6 crowd, the McDonalds down the road has one of those nice COOLED indoor play facilities as well, which may be welcome in August.
Knowing what to do with 4-6 y/o is always a challenge. Perhaps some of the other attendies will have kids along as well and will chime in.
I try and remember to ask my wife what her thoughts would be.
Zoo is just hot and miserable that time of year, though its a nice zoo generally. Perhaps an early AM trip to the zoo would be OK. Its a trek -- about 30 miles.
For kids/adults that like hunting, a trip to Cabellas is no bad idea either.
